Band 7 / Band 6 Trainee (depending on experience) Clinical Nurse / Midwife Specialist in Early Pregnancy and Emergency Gynaecology

An exciting opportunity has arisen for an experienced Early Pregnancy & Emergency Gynaecology Clinical Nurse / Midwife Specialist at Band 7 with a qualification in Medical Ultrasound OR a nurse / midwife with a real interest wishing to undergo training at Band
6. This is a full‑time permanent position at our Early Pregnancy & Acute Gynaecology Unit (EPAGU) (The Elizabeth Suite), at Chelsea & Westminster Hospital.

The Elizabeth Suite is a bespoke EPAG Unit specifically designed to provide emergency care and support for women with complications in early stages of pregnancy up to 17 + 6 weeks and emergency care for acute gynaecology complications unrelated to pregnancy through direct internal referral from our Emergency Department and other services.

This Unit has a range of rooms, each designed for scanning and clinical investigation. Minor out‑patient procedures are also performed including manual vacuum aspiration, Word catheter insertion and intrauterine contraceptive device insertion and retrieval.

The service ethos is to provide time‑critical rapid assessment of our women within a one‑stop clinical model in close liaison with our A&E and GP colleagues. The Unit delivers specialist, evidence‑based, holistic care to women with early pregnancy and gynaecology complications in an environment that supports patient choice and dignity. The multi‑professional team consists of consultant gynaecologists, clinical nurse specialists, clinical research fellows and specialist sonographers.

The successful candidate must have experience of gynaecology and early pregnancy management and treatment. They must have or wish to pursue a qualification in early pregnancy and gynaecology scanning. The post requires excellent prioritising and verbal and non‑verbal and counselling skills.

Key Responsibilities
  • To receive, triage and manage referrals independently.
  • To chase, interpret and manage blood test results, histology results and other.
  • To manage outpatient caseloads independently.
  • To independently manage the telephone clinic and telephone protected lunch hours.
  • To independently run scan clinics.
  • To participate in counselling, discussion of options and management of cases.
  • To assist / participate in procedures.
  • To assist with emergency admissions and urgent cases.
  • To independently run the clinic / lead by managing the capacity on a daily basis, escalating concerns and liaising with consultants.
  • To participate / conduct audits.
  • To teach / support other colleagues in learning pathways.
  • To work flexibly as per rota supporting clinic cover on weekends, bank holidays and cross‑site cover when necessary.
Notes

If starting as a trainee, the post‑holder will be expected to complete their sonography training and competencies within two years of starting in post.

It would be expected that on successful completion of their training the post‑holder would be able to work independently as a Nurse/Midwife Sonographer/Specialist and automatically progress to band 7.
